Anambra to participate in World Student Debate, 2023

By Robinson Esighasim
ALL is set for Anambra State’s participation in 2023World Student Debate coming up later in Malaysia.
Commissioner for Education, Ngozi Chuma-Udeh, gave the hint during a media forum in Awka.
Explaining that arrangements are being concluded to make the state’s participation grand in reflection of Gov. Chukwuma Soludo’s Midas touch in Anambra’s basic education sector, Prof. Chuma-Udeh said this will also help the state’s contingent sweep the prizes and awards at the debate.
Christened, Soludo Solution Team, Chuma-Udeh said the delegation will have no choice than to make Anambra proud in order to justify Gov. Souldo’s recalibration of the basic education sector through recent recruitment of 5,000 teachers at a go that ended era of schools without teachers, approval of scholarship scheme for over 180 indigent children from riverine areas and enrollment of out-of-school children, as well as re-introduction of history into Anambra school curriculum.
Chuma-Udeh also used the forum to unveil 10 awards brought home by Anambra teams from different competitions in the past one year, including five presidential teachers’ awards among others.
